the elderly lady who loves nearby has fingers that are gnarled with rheumatoid
arthritis. Meanwhile, electric hedge clippers these days are made with
triggers that take a lot more force than years ago - and so does the
thumb-operated catch that lets you lock the clipper into the 'on' position.
Is there any way to make it easier for her?
The problem here is that if the person lacks the hand strength to
operate the safety device, they probably also lack the hand strength to
safely operate the device.
